How to fill out pH and pOH chemistry:
01
Start by understanding the concept of pH and pOH. pH is a measure of the acidity or alkalinity of a solution, while pOH is a measure of the concentration of hydroxide ions in a solution.
02
Determine the substances or compounds you are working with and their corresponding chemical reactions. pH and pOH calculations typically involve acids and bases, so it is important to identify whether the substance is an acid or a base.
03
Use the appropriate formulas to calculate pH and pOH. For pH calculations, use the formula pH = -log[H+], where [H+] is the concentration of hydrogen ions in the solution. For pOH calculations, use the formula pOH = -log[OH-], where [OH-] is the concentration of hydroxide ions. Remember that pH + pOH = 14 in a neutral solution at room temperature.
04
Determine the concentration of the ions in the solution. This can be done by measuring the concentration directly (if given) or by using stoichiometry and the balanced chemical equation of the reaction.
05
Plug the concentration values into the appropriate formula and solve for pH or pOH. Remember to take the negative logarithm of the concentration.
06
Validate your calculation by comparing it to the known pH or pOH values of common substances or using a pH indicator or pH meter.
07
Interpret the calculated pH or pOH value. A low pH value indicates acidity, whereas a high pH value indicates alkalinity. pH values ranging from 0 to 7 are acidic, while values from 7 to 14 are basic or alkaline.
08
Take into account any additional factors, such as temperature, pressure, or presence of other solutes, that may affect the pH and pOH calculations.
Who needs pH and pOH chemistry:
01
Chemistry students: pH and pOH calculations are fundamental concepts in chemistry, particularly in areas such as acid-base reactions and chemical equilibrium. Understanding pH and pOH is essential for students studying chemistry at any level.
02
Researchers and scientists: pH and pOH measurements are crucial in various scientific fields, including biochemistry, environmental science, and pharmaceutical research. Researchers often need to determine the pH of solutions for their experiments or analyze the effects of pH on chemical reactions and biological processes.
03
Environmentalists and water quality analysts: pH plays a crucial role in assessing the quality and health of natural water bodies. Monitoring pH levels in lakes, rivers, and oceans helps identify acidic or alkaline conditions, which can have a significant impact on aquatic ecosystems. Water quality analysts also rely on pH measurements to ensure safe drinking water and proper wastewater treatment.
04
Medical professionals and healthcare workers: pH measurements are vital in biomedical sciences and healthcare. Monitoring the pH of body fluids and tissues helps diagnose various conditions and diseases, such as acid-base imbalances, respiratory disorders, and urinary tract infections.
05
Industrial professionals: pH and pOH measurements are used in many industrial processes, including food and beverage production, chemical manufacturing, and wastewater treatment. Maintaining specific pH levels is necessary for optimal product quality, chemical reactions, and environmental compliance.
06
Home gardeners and farmers: pH levels affect plant health and growth. Understanding and adjusting the pH of soil or water used for irrigation helps optimize nutrient availability and uptake by plants, ultimately improving crop yield and quality.
In summary, understanding pH and pOH chemistry is essential for chemistry students, researchers, environmentalists, medical professionals, industrial professionals, and home gardeners. These concepts are used to measure acidity or alkalinity, assess water quality, diagnose medical conditions, optimize industrial processes, and enhance crop production.
